#a68c05 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a68c05 is composed of 65.1% red, 54.9%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.7% magenta, 97%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 50.3 degrees, a saturation of 94.2% and a lightness of 33.5%. #a68c05 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0a with #4d1900.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

#a68c05 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a68c05 has RGB values of R:166, G:140,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.97,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10914821.

Shades and Tints of #a68c05
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0c00 is the darkest color, while #fffef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#a68c05
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575754 is the less saturated color, while #a68c05 is the most saturated one.
